Senior Algorithm Engineer
Dexcom. Contribute to R&D projects in TDI, working with a team of experts in advanced algorithmic treatments, diagnostics, and insights for diabetes, pre-diabetes, and health and longevity, enhancing care from HCPs and helping people to treat better, eat better, sleep better, and live better.

About the role
Key responsibilities & impact- Contribute to R&D projects in TDI, working with a team of experts in advanced algorithmic treatments, diagnostics, and insights for diabetes, pre-diabetes, and health and longevity, enhancing care from HCPs and helping people to treat better, eat better, sleep better, and live better.
- Analyze clinical trial and health records data.
- Perform modeling and design activities, and be involved in selecting the appropriate methods to apply, including both data-driven and model-based methods.
- Help to identify and sell innovation opportunities for TDI, responding to needs articulated by Dexcom’s commercial and strategic planning teams.
- Develop prototype software within an agile R&D framework that supports massively parallel simulation.
- Document and communicate your work.
- Work with cross-functional teams in support of downstream commercialization efforts.
Requirements
What you’ll need- Hunger to make the world a better place by developing advanced algorithmic treatments, diagnostics, and insights for diabetes, pre-diabetes, and health and longevity.
- Experience working with complex data from diverse sources, including clinical study data.
- Experience with first principles and/or data-driven modeling methods.
- Experience translating models into signal processing, control, and/or decision-support algorithms in a biomedical context.
- Comfortable with common software development and data analysis platforms (Python, R, Matlab, or other similar environments) and practice modern software development methods.
- Strong written and oral communication skills, suitable for diverse audiences ranging from your peers within TDI to Dexcom leadership.
- Ideally exposed to glucose-insulin metabolic health concepts, models, and technology.
- Ideally participated in the design of clinical trial end points and monitored their collection and analysis.
- Ideally have a master's degree or higher in Electrical, Biomedical, or Systems Engineering, Computer Science, or a related field.
- Ideally have experience with cloud computing environments such as GCP or AWS.
